**pyThermoGIS** is a Python package that provides API access to the [ThermoGIS](https://www.thermogis.nl/en) doublet simulations and economic calculations,  ThermoGIS is developed and maintained by the [Geological Survey of the Netherlands](https://www.geologischedienst.nl/en/) which is part of [TNO](https://www.tno.nl/en/), additionally, pythermogis was also partially developed by and for the [GoForward](https://go-forward-project.eu/) project.
